◆ China also went scoreless, ‘3rd place down’… 0-1 loss to Qatar, 3rd place, 16th-strength ‘distrust’
China, which suffered from a severe lack of goal-making power, lost 0-1 to Qatar, which operated a rotation member, in the final third match of Group A at the 2023 Asian Cup held at Khalifa International Stadium in Al-Raiyan, Qatar on the 23rd (Korea time). China’s leading striker Wu Lei played as a substitute member in the second half after being excluded from the starting lineup due to poor performance, but he also failed to shake the net.

As a result, China, which has advanced to its 13th finals, finished third in the group with two draws and one loss (two points) without even a single win, and is in a position to watch the results of the final matches of other groups. However, Indonesia, ranked third in Group D, which includes Japan, has already secured three points (1 win and one loss), and Bahrain, ranked third in Group E, which includes Korea, also has three points (1 win and one loss), making it difficult for China to advance to the round of 16 for the third place.

Moreover, Syria (1 draw, 1 loss point), ranked third in Group B, will play India with two losses, and Palestine (1 draw, 1 loss point), ranked third in Group C, will play Hong Kong with two losses, respectively, and is more likely to advance to the round of 16 than China. Oman (1 draw, 1 loss point), ranked third in Group F, also played against Kyrgyzstan, the lowest with two losses, and China’s advance to the round of 16 remains arithmetically.
Qatar, the host country and defending champion, confirmed its advance to the round of 16 by winning two consecutive games, while having its ace Akram Afif (three goals) and Almoez Ali (one goal) start from the bench, securing the top spot in the group with three consecutive wins (nine points) without allowing any loss for three consecutive games. Qatar will play against the third-ranked team in Group C, D and E in the round of 16, and will thus have a relatively advantageous match. By granting rotation members a chance to play, Qatar is now making it to the knockout stage, raising hopes for its second consecutive win.

As China failed to score even one goal in three consecutive games, head coach Aleksandar Jankovic also had nothing to say. He seemed to take the lead in the beginning with strong forward pressure and rapid change of offense, but failed to take advantage of the scoring opportunity and eventually collapsed in the second half. China was lagging behind 41% to 59% in ball possession rate and was also inferior to 70% to 83% in pass success rate. The number of shots was the same as 10 to 10, but they couldn’t avoid losing 0-1 by missing one big chance.

At the start of the second half, Qatar replaced three players including the goalkeeper, showing its willingness to win three consecutive games. At the 19th minute of the second half when the 0-0 balance continued, it shook China’s net by simultaneously putting in ace Afif and captain Hassan al-Haidos. At the 21st minute of the second half, Afif kicked the ball behind the penalty box in the left corner, and “Captain” al-Haidos scored the “wonder winning goal” with a non-stop volley shot from about 21 meters in front of the penalty box.

Afif, who is tied for first in individual scoring with three goals in the tournament, added one assist with an accurate kick.
